Output 0f7717f89cf60db3f591d8a931d0e037c7c9c43ea94ffdfb453b9fc066388612:0

value
84973966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67a9a1a357ac54c4e200249f62516d8e7f6c0fc5 OP_EQUAL
address
MHMH3PH9KgtG5vWTsVMEa5eyNfPkYEHax6
transaction
0f7717f89cf60db3f591d8a931d0e037c7c9c43ea94ffdfb453b9fc066388612
spent
true